Have a doctor examine a lump if it’s hard, sore, bleeding, swelling, rapidly growing, persistent, or located on your testicles or breasts. Unexplained bumps and lumps can appear on different parts of your body. If the lump is soft and rolls easily under your fingers, it is probably benign. Moreover, there are many different types of lumps that can form under your skin. An abscess is a round, pus-filled lump that develops when bacteria enter your skin through a cut or wound. From another angle, cysts: How to Tell the Difference and When to See a ....
It’s not unusual to discover a lump beneath your skin, perhaps on your neck, in your armpit, or near your jaw, and immediately feel concerned. These lumps are often either swollen lymph nodes or cysts.
